2012-01-02 14:57:50 Jean-Baptiste Lallement description open system monitor switch to tab processe select any process press down and up key continusaly a popup will appear this is a 32-bit problem see the images: http://ubuntuforums.org/attachment.php?attachmentid=210046&d=1325422483 http://ubuntuforums.org/attachment.php?attachmentid=210106&stc=1&thumb=1&d=1325500407 http://ubuntuforums.org/attachment.php?attachmentid=210115&d=1325512351 may 32-bit users are facing problem see the threads: http://ubuntuforums.org/showthread.php?p=11581200#post11581200 http://ubuntuforums.org/showthread.php?t=1902931 this bug is for 32-bit ubuntu users dont know about other vairants many are facing(32-bit users) ProblemType: Bug DistroRelease: Ubuntu 12.04 Package: gnome-system-monitor 3.3.3-0ubuntu1 ProcVersionSignature: Ubuntu 3.2.0-7.13-generic 3.2.0-rc7 Uname: Linux 3.2.0-7-generic i686 NonfreeKernelModules: nvidia ApportVersion: 1.90-0ubuntu1 Architecture: i386 Date: Mon Jan 2 19:19:20 2012 ExecutablePath: /usr/bin/gnome-system-monitor InstallationMedia: Ubuntu 11.10 "Oneiric Ocelot" - Release i386 (20111012) ProcEnviron:  LANGUAGE=en_IN:en  PATH=(custom, no user)  LANG=en_IN  SHELL=/bin/bash SourcePackage: gnome-system-monitor UpgradeStatus: Upgraded to precise on 2011-12-25 (7 days ago) TEST CASE 1. Launch gnome-system-monitor as a normal user 2. Scroll down the list and select the process 'pulseaudio' OR Select the first process and scroll down to the bottom of the list EXPECTED RESULT Nothing special happens ACTUAL RESULT A popup appears with the following message: "Cannot change the priority of process with PID 2640 to -20.
